Re: Where was Gondor's main field army during the War of the Ring?

Minas Tirith isn't the only place they are battling.

In the book (and extended editions), when Aragorn, Legolas and Gimli exit the Dimholt (with the army of the dead), they find themselves in Southern Gondor, watching Corsairs of Umbar fighting against the armies of Southern Gondor. After the dead help defeat the Corsairs of Umbar, they load the ships up with all the southern soldiers and go to Minas Tirith.

The film also does a poor job of depicting the many soldiers, including the Knights of Dol Amroth, that came to Minas Tirith to defend the city.
